BigMo763 Posted November 17, 2010 Share Posted November 17, 2010 I'm not too familiar with DLC licensing, so hopefully somebody can provide some insight. I want to finish some achievements I am missing that require DLC (Saint's Row 2, for example). My buddy has the DLC on his console, so if I recover my profile on his console or transport it using a USB memory stick will I be able to play the DLC? Just want to see if anyone knows if this is possible before I spend the MS Points...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
kaleido42 Posted November 17, 2010 Share Posted November 17, 2010 DLC can only be played by the gamertag that originally downloaded it while they are online or by anyone on the console that originally downloaded it while online or offline. Any other circumstances and you won't have access to it.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

kaleido42 Posted November 17, 2010 Share Posted November 17, 2010 So if I recover my profile onto his console I can play the DLC if he also plays or is signed in, correct? He didn't quite get that right. As long as its played on the console that originally downloaded it, anyone can access and play it no matter who is online or offline. So you could recover your profile onto his console (or move it with a usb stick) and play it, but there is no need for him to be online. It can also be played on your console, but to do so, you would need his gamertag on your console, and he would have to be online (from your console) while you play it.
